I thought the Ali Act made that illegal? Meaning illegal to force a fighter to sign with you to get a world title shot. Not illegal to force a fighter to sign to get a regular shot at Canelo
This might be what your referring to.
c) PROTECTION FROM COERCIVE CONTRACTS WITH BROADCASTERS- Subsection (a) of this section applies to any contract between a commercial broadcaster and a boxer, or granting any rights with respect to that boxer, involving a broadcast in or affecting interstate commerce, regardless of the broadcast medium. For the purpose of this subsection, any reference in subsection (a)(1)(B) to ‘promoter’ shall be considered a reference to ‘commercial broadcaster’.
I'm assuming that covers what your talking about because section a and b refer to restricting trade. So Golovkin rights are restricted if he is forced to sign in order to get a rematch.
